import type { ErrorType } from '../../errors/utils.js' import type { AuthorizationRequest, SignedAuthorization, } from '../../types/authorization.js' import type { Hex, Signature } from '../../types/misc.js' import type { Prettify } from '../../types/utils.js' import { type HashAuthorizationErrorType, hashAuthorization, } from '../../utils/authorization/hashAuthorization.js' import { type SignErrorType, type SignParameters, type SignReturnType, sign, } from './sign.js' type To = 'object' | 'bytes' | 'hex' export type SignAuthorizationParameters<to extends To = 'object'> = AuthorizationRequest & { /** The private key to sign with. */ privateKey: Hex to?: SignParameters<to>['to'] | undefined } export type SignAuthorizationReturnType<to extends To = 'object'> = Prettify< to extends 'object' ? SignedAuthorization : SignReturnType<to> > export type SignAuthorizationErrorType = | SignErrorType | HashAuthorizationErrorType | ErrorType /** * Signs an Authorization hash in [EIP-7702 format](https://eips.ethereum.org/EIPS/eip-7702): `keccak256('0x05' || rlp([chain_id, address, nonce]))`. */ export async function signAuthorization<to extends To = 'object'>( parameters: SignAuthorizationParameters<to>, ): Promise<SignAuthorizationReturnType<to>> { const { chainId, nonce, privateKey, to = 'object' } = parameters const address = parameters.contractAddress ?? parameters.address const signature = await sign({ hash: hashAuthorization({ address, chainId, nonce }), privateKey, to, }) if (to === 'object') return { address, chainId, nonce, ...(signature as Signature), } as any return signature as any }
